Depends on what you are trying to do and what software you want to use. If your just looking at info and pulling codes. The regular scan tool will be fine. I have an OTC that's OK for repair but will not work with the software like tuner pro.
If you are wanting to log data in tuner pro or aldl droid in order to burn a chip that actually improves your van, the regular scan tool will most likely not work with those. The good part about the above bluetooth aldl is it can read and clear codes as well. https://play.google.com/store/apps/d....scan&hl=en_US i use Johns app a few times and it logs data just fine.
$90 for datalogging? Ouch. I use the Moates Autoprom. I have the older version that is close to 15 years old. Still works well. I l had to get a replacement OBD connector a couple of years ago. Said my unit was a dinosaur and somehow found a new old cable laying around his shop. Also has excellet customer service. I datalog and tune real time.
